Subject: On-call handover — Tabulax sort stability

Hi Marek, handing over. The Tabulax report builder regression is still open: the new comparator isn't stable, so rows with equal keys reorder between runs, which breaks the audit-diff checks the security reviewer relies on. I've pinned the old comparator behind a flag as a stopgap. Nothing indicates tampering — it's a pure sorting bug. Follow-up questions on the audit impact can go here.

escalation mailbox, bafog-fafog: ulador@paliqlabs.internal

# Client setup for `tailgrim`, the internal log-tailing CLI.
# Contractors: tailgrim streams from the Ostmere log broker only;
# prod tails are read-only and rate-limited to 500 lines/sec.
# Use --since with a duration, never absolute timestamps, or the
# broker rejects the cursor. The client below authenticates to the
# Ostmere broker with the internal service key that follows.

service key, yadug-bajog: zpat3_pou

## Firmware Channels — Lampwick Environments

Welcome aboard! Lampwick pushes device firmware through three channels: canary, beta, and stable. New contractors usually touch beta only — canary is reserved for the hardware lab in Driftmoor, and stable changes need sign-off from Priya on the platform team. Each channel has its own rollout throttle and signing key rotation window, so don't copy settings between them blindly. The current beta channel configuration is as follows.

config for kawif-hahig:
zorix:
  log_level: error
  metrics_host: metrics.zorix.lumiclabs.internal
  pool_size: 16

Lost badge — Tarnwell Systems. Report it immediately to Reception, Building C. Do not wait until end of day. Reception deactivates the badge and issues a replacement within two hours. Tailgating through doors while badgeless is a policy violation, even on day one. Borrowed badges are also prohibited. Keep your temporary paper pass visible until the replacement arrives. For door access during the gap, use the interim code below.

staff pass of baduf-tawig = bdg-JZQJMP-06442516